“I never planned on becoming a teacher in war zones… but life had other plans.
I am Hema Vinod, and my journey in education has taken me from the classrooms of India to refugee camps and conflict zones across the world. I’ve spent over three decades dedicated to helping displaced communities, and along the way, discovered my purpose in empowering young minds and their families.
My journey began in India as a teacher, but when my husband’s work took us to Uganda, I continued teaching. But soon my path shifted to something I could never have imagined, working with UNHCR and later UNICEF.
For over 15 years, I served in conflict-affected countries like Yemen, Somalia, Iraq, Sri Lanka, and Uganda. I worked with refugee children, rebuilt schools, trained teachers, and witnessed the courage of families who valued education even when survival was uncertain.
Everywhere I went, I saw children risk everything just to attend school, and I realized that education in those moments wasn’t just about learning. It was about dignity. It was about hope.
When I returned to India, I chose to reinvent myself, this time as a coach and bestselling author, writing for teens and their parents. My books and my new community, Parenteening for Moms, are an extension of the same mission: giving families strength and resilience to navigate life’s toughest years.
